Global Bonds on Display: New Exhibition at National Museum of China

Mark your calendars for a powerful journey through history at the National Museum of China! On September 9, a one-of-a-kind exhibition opened its doors, celebrating the incredible international friends who stood by China’s side during the War of Resistance Against Japanese Aggression. 🌏❤️

Featuring over 700 photographs and artifacts—from letters exchanged by frontline medics to personal items carried across oceans—this exhibit shines a light on the global solidarity that helped shape modern China. Each snapshot tells a story of bravery, compassion, and cross-cultural connections forged in the most challenging times. 📸✨

Top highlights include:

  • Rare wartime photographs capturing medical teams from the UK, US, and Australia
  • Original letters and diaries revealing personal bonds
  • Artifacts like field medical kits and handcrafted gifts from abroad
